Little bets : how breakthrough ideas emerge from small discoveries / Peter Sims.

By: Sims, Peter (Peter E.).
Publisher: London : Random House Business, 2011Description: vii, 213 p. : ill. ; 24 cm.ISBN: 9781847940476; 1847940471.Subject(s): Success in business | Creative abilityDDC classification: 658.409
Contents:
Big bets versus little bets -- The growth mind-set -- Failing quickly to learn fast -- The genius of play -- Problems are the new solutions -- Questions are the new answers -- Learning a little from a lot -- Learning a lot from a little -- Small wins -- Conclusion.
